The purpose of this 6-hour introductory seminar is to provide an overview of the statistical techniques that are commonly used in business for both data analysis and decision making. A basic discussion of descriptive statistics will be presented as a means of summarizing data to help make informed decisions. The presentation also includes topics such as probability theory, measures of summary statistics, and statistical estimation. Emphasis will be placed on both understanding and communicating of statistical results through common analysis displays such as tables, charts, graphs, and scatterplots. Prior coursework or knowledge of statistics is not required.
